- 02DevOps & Cloud Infrastructure
> AUTOMATION THAT KEEPS SYSTEMS RELIABLE <
Modern cloud infrastructure requires more than servers. It demands automation, monitoring, and processes that catch problems before users notice them. DevOps practices bring together development and operations into workflows that deploy changes safely and roll back quickly when needed. Infrastructure as code means your entire environment is documented, repeatable, and version controlled. Our team implements CI/CD pipelines, container orchestration with Kubernetes, and real time monitoring that provides visibility into system health. Massachusetts businesses need IT infrastructure that handles traffic spikes, maintains business continuity, and meets strict uptime requirements. We build these capabilities into every layer, from virtual machines to networking to automated security scanning.

- 03Cloud Migration Services
> MOVING WORKLOADS WITHOUT BREAKING OPERATIONS <
Cloud migration is not just copying files to new servers. It requires careful assessment of dependencies, data storage patterns, and application architecture. Some systems benefit from lift and shift approaches. Others need rearchitecting to take advantage of cloud native capabilities. The wrong approach leads to higher costs and worse performance than staying on premises. We handle cloud migration services with a structured process: assessment, planning, pilot testing, and phased execution. Massachusetts organizations often run legacy systems that connect to dozens of other applications. Our engineers map these connections, identify risks, and execute migrations with minimal disruption to daily operations. Data security stays paramount throughout, with encryption in transit and at rest.

How do you help optimize cloud services costs after migration?
Cost optimization starts during architecture design, not after bills arrive. We implement tagging strategies that attribute spending to specific projects and teams. Reserved capacity and savings plans reduce costs for predictable workloads. Regular reviews identify unused resources and over provisioned instances. Automated policies shut down development environments outside business hours. The goal is cost efficiency that does not require constant manual attention or sacrifice performance when it matters.
